Job Description:

A vacancy for a Constellations Satellite Systems Engineer has arisen within Airbus Defence & Space in Madrid (Getafe). The successful applicant will join the EOS Chief Engineering Department in Spain. We are seeking a highly skilled Constellations Satellite Systems Engineer with background in small satellite and constellation systems development. In this role, you will lead the engineering efforts for satellite development projects, with a particular emphasis on the industrialization, design-to-cost and design-to-manufacturing of small- and mid-sized satellites. The main focus of this position is the development of ISR constellations for national and European customers. You will work in a multi-disciplinary system engineering team and will be a key contributor to the on-cost, on-time and on-quality product delivery to our customers.

Job Responsibility:

  • Acting as satellite chief engineer, lead the engineering team in the design, development, and testing of satellite systems, ensuring adherence to project requirements and industry standards
  • Establish constellation concepts responding to customer requirements and needs, deriving from the constellation concept the constellation system, satellite, platform and payload requirements
  • Establish Concepts of Operations meeting stakeholders expectations
  • Define the overall development schedule of satellite systems, with a focus on technology maturation processes, establishing and maintaining internal and external dependencies
  • Drive the adaptation of existing satellite product lines to ensure satisfying customer requirements while enabling mid-scale industrialization of the satellite concept
  • Define the satellite product breakdown structure, and identify industrial partners for its development
  • Maintain the overall engineering schedule for the satellite system, aligned with the development logic
  • Remain accountable for the OTOQOC execution of engineering activities in the satellite system development and implementation
  • Establish end-to-end performance budgets, ensuring flow-down of performance requirements to platform, payload, subsystems and equipment
  • Maintain end-to-end performance budgets, including the bottom-up verification process
  • Drive the verification and validation activities throughout the satellite lifecycle, from initial concept to on-orbit operation
  • Lead / Contribute to the execution of program milestones and reviews
  • The deployment of novel engineering methods, processes and tools (e.g. MBSE, multi-disciplinary analyses, concurrent design engineering…)
  • The digitalisation of our design, development and manufacturing processes (e.g. DDMS), and their smooth implementation across all involved disciplines
